On the music front Steve Morse is a incredibly talented guitarist. As far as I know he started in the band the Dixie Dregs. They are a southern progressive rock band, imagine that. Since then he has made at least ten solo albums, returned to occasionally work the Dregs and lately he has replaced Ritchie Blackmore as lead guitarist in that hard rock band from the 70's Deep Purple. If you appreciate complex progressive rock, and who listens to Yes and doesn't, you'll like Steve Morse and the Dixie Dregs.

Gilmour's solo stuff is well a lot like what Pink Floyd has been doing lately, go figure. I haven't heard his latest album Music for a Island, but his fist album self titled David Gilmour is my favorite so far, it's very well composed and very moving though it's not over produced. About Face, his second album, came out about the same time as Final Cut, it borders on over production, with multiple instrument lost in the mix, but still a great album. Lyrically it's a lot stronger and there are some very talented names in the guest roster. All in all good stuff. I am convinced that David Gilmour is too professional to make bad albums.
